One killed in major fire in Ernakulam’s oil company

KOCHI: A major fire broke out at an oil company in Ernakulam’s Edayar. Reports say one person has been killed in the accident. The fire broke out at the oil manufacturing company C G Lubricants Thursday morning at 8.30 am. The fire brigade has reached the spot and are trying to douse the flames.

It is not clear how many employees are in the building. Nearly eight fire brigade units have reached the spot. All efforts are being taken to douse the flames and enter the building. The locals said a big explosion was also heard.
